Overview
- Winnipeg improved to 17-22-5 with its first one-goal victory since Nov. 15, while New Jersey fell to 22-21-2 with a fourth straight loss.
- Alex Iafallo, Jonathan Toews and Gabriel Vilardi also scored for the Jets; Josh Morrissey and Cole Perfetti had two assists each and Connor Hellebuyck made 24 saves.
- Cody Glass scored twice for the Devils and Nico Hischier added one, with Jack Hughes and Luke Hughes registering two assists apiece.
- Jets defenseman Colin Miller left in the first period with a lower-body injury after an awkward hit and did not return.
- New Jersey made Johnathan Kovacevic’s season debut and scratched Dougie Hamilton as trade speculation swirled; next up are the Wild on Monday for the Devils and the Islanders on Tuesday for the Jets.
